> Maybe we can get the kernel drivers to expose the information we need
> (maybe even an 'eject' attribute in sysfs or something) and then we just
> have to write udev rules instead of having a whole bunch of libusb junk
> in userspace?  Would that preserve the policy-always-in-userspace
> requirement yet keep the code to drive the hardware in kernel space
> where it really belongs?

Or put the magic strings in the kernel with a translation hook for the
eject request ? That would keep policy and method in the right places.
You ask the kernel to eject, it hides the magic weirdness.
